The Most Powerful Leadership Resource You Have

Meridith Elliott Powell - 5 November 2018

Why Neglecting This One Kills Performance.
This past week I started a new round of LEAD – a leadership development program I run for high potentials in organizations. Young leaders who are slated to move into Executive Level Leadership Positions within the next five to ten years.
The custom programs always begin with allowing each class to choose the first program. The first lesson they want to learn on this leadership journey. It’s funny, even though the classes are different, the individuals unique, and the company’s goals for the program specific to their industry, the first class almost always chooses the same program
I have more than twenty of these under my belt now, and for eighteen of those, including this most recent, the first program centers around coaching. This session is where participants learn about what exactly coaching is, how to design a coaching session, and what they need to get started
